Come as You Are
by Ben Glover, David Crowder, and Matt Maher. Used by Permission.
with Come Ye Disconsolate (lyrics - Thomas Moore 1816 ed by Thomas Hastings 1831, melody - CONSOLATION by Samuel Webbe 1792)
The Glover, Crowder, and Maher song is an updated version of a grand old hymn, Come Ye Disconsolate. The 18th century melody is so lovely that it deserves a hearing beside Come As You Are.
